HUNDREDS of brave ticketholders visited a historic fort which was transformed into a fortress of fear for the return of a popular fright night.

Charity group, the Harwich Angels, organised the fright night at Beacon Hill Fort, in Dovercourt, last Friday, to raise money for two local causes.

Andrea King, event organiser and member of the Harwich Angels, said the event was a huge success.

She said: “We’ve raised £1,016 and we had about 420 people attend, so the night was really good.”

Half of the money has been donated to help restore the fort, and the other half will be used by the Harwich Angels for Christmas causes.

Mrs King added: “We’d like to thank the owners of the fort for letting us use the property.

“We had about 70 volunteers dress up on the night, both Harwich Angels’ volunteers and residents helped us out.”

This is the second consecutive year the fright night has been held at the fort.

Organisers have promised to hold it again next year and hope it will be even bigger and better.
